THESE ARE THE TOOLS YOU
WILL NEED FOR ASSEMBLY:
(1) 3/16" Allen Wrench
(1) 1/2" Wrench
(2) 9/16" Wrenches
(1) 9/16" Socket
(1) 1/2" Socket
(1) Drive Ratchet
(1) 3" or longer Extension
(1) Phillips Screwdriver
(1) Flat Blade Screwdriver
CAUTION:
BEFORE ASSEMBLING
ACTUATOR KIT TO TRACTOR:
Depress clutch/brake pedal fully and set parking brake.
i
Place gearshift/motion
control lever in "NEUTRAL"
position.
Place attachment clutch in "DISENGAGED"
position,
Turn ignition key "OFF" and remove key.
Make sure the blade and all moving parts have completely stopped.
Disconnect spark plug wire from spark plug(s) and place wire where it cannot come in contact
with plug,
NOTE: When right hand (R.H.) and left hand (L.H.) are mentioned in this manual, it means when you are seated on the
tractor, in the operator's position.
NOTE: The illustrations shown in this manual are to aid in the assembly and operation of this kit. The illustrations may
not show your particular tractor model.
SET-UP
(See Figs. 1,2 & 3)
1.
Remove mower deck if installed (refer to your
"Tractor Owner's Manual" for instructions).
2.
Remove cap, E-Ring, and washer from axle on both
rear wheels.
3.
Place a suitable size block of wood under drawbar
bracket.
4.
Remove rear wheels.
5.
Relieve any tension on attachment
lift spring by
loosening jam nut and adjustment bolt.
6.
Remove socket head screw from lift lever. Remove
lift lever.
NOTE: Use block of wood to assist in lift handle removal.
7.
Fit the tapered lift lever hub on lift shaft. Secure with
3/8-16 xl-3/8 hex bolt provided in kit and tighten
securely.
